Understanding Frankincense Essential Oil
Frankincense essential oil, derived from the resin of the Boswellia tree, has been used for centuries in various cultures for its aromatic and therapeutic properties. Its rich history includes applications in religious rituals, traditional medicine, and skincare. However, as interest in essential oils grows, so does the question of their safety, particularly regarding ingestion.
Despite its various health benefits, frankincense essential oil is highly concentrated and potent. This concentration means that even small amounts can produce significant effects on the body. The compounds found in frankincense, such as boswellic acids, are known for their anti-inflammatory and potential anticancer properties, but these effects can vary widely depending on individual health conditions and how the oil is prepared or diluted.

The safety of ingesting frankincense essential oil is a topic of considerable debate among health professionals. While some practitioners advocate for its internal use, others caution against it due to the lack of extensive research on the long-term effects and potential toxicity. Essential oils, including frankincense, can cause adverse reactions if not consumed correctly, making it essential to consult a healthcare professional before considering ingestion.
Additionally, the quality of the essential oil plays a crucial role in its safety. Many products on the market may contain additives, contaminants, or synthetic ingredients that could pose health risks. Therefore, it is vital to choose high-quality, therapeutic-grade essential oils if one is considering ingestion, and to follow recommended dosages strictly.

If ingestion feels risky or is discouraged, there are several safe and effective alternatives to benefit from frankincense essential oil. One popular method is aromatherapy, where the oil is diffused into the air, allowing its soothing aroma to promote relaxation and mental clarity. This method avoids the risks associated with ingestion while still providing some of the oil’s therapeutic benefits.
Another alternative is topical application. When diluted properly with a carrier oil, frankincense essential oil can be applied to the skin for localized benefits, such as reducing inflammation or promoting skin health. However, it is essential to perform a patch test first to check for any allergic reactions or skin sensitivities.
